What Are Twitter Lists?

Lists on Twitter are a handy feature that lets you curate a custom timeline. Twitter Lists give you control over what you see, unlike the typical timeline, which contains a mixture of different information. This includes people you follow and recommendations that Twitter's algorithm thinks you might find interesting.

Even better, you can pin your favorite Twitter lists on top of your home timeline to create an easily accessible secondary timeline. That's one of the main reasons why you should embrace Twitter Lists in the first place.

On Twitter, you can join lists and create your own, and so can anyone else. So don't be surprised if you find you're part of someone's list on Twitter.

How to See Which Twitter Lists You're On

Anyone can add you to their lists on Twitter. The good thing is you will know when they do. But the downside is, Twitter will not let you know if someone has added you to a private list. As such, you may be part of a list that you don't want to be a member of.

And, the worse part is, someone may use this feature to harass you. But don't fret; that shouldn't make you ditch Twitter completely.

Twitter has a feature that lets you view all the lists you're a member of. You can view the lists you're part of on Twitter via the web or mobile apps. We will show you how to check on both platforms.

If you're using Twitter on the web, follow these steps:

  1. Click Lists from the left-side menu bar.
  2. Under the Lists page, tap the three-dot menu in the upper-right corner.
  3. Select Lists You're On. This will take you to a page where you can all the lists you're a member of.

On Android and iOS, follow these steps:

  1. Tap your profile picture in the upper-left corner.
  2. Tap Lists and select the three-dot menu in the upper-right corner.
  3. Finally, tap Lists you're on to see which Twitter lists you are part of.

That's how you check all the list's that you've been added on.

How to Remove Yourself from Lists on Twitter

If you want to remove yourself, there's only one way to do it. That's by blocking the creator of the list, according to Twitter support.

To remove yourself from a list by blocking the creator, follow these steps:

  1. Select the Twitter list you want to remove yourself from.
  2. Tap the three dots in the upper-right corner of the list page.
  3. Select Block @creatorname.
  4. Tap Block and repeat to confirm. This will remove you from that list in an instant.

If you don't want to block the list creator permanently, you can unblock them after that. But if you do this, they can still add you to their lists in the future.
